The purpose of this study is to analyze the Ketamine with its anti-inflammatory profile would be able to prevent cognitive disorders in the postoperative period of cardiac surgery, since these disorders contribute to an impact on morbidity / mortality in this population.

RECRUITINGChange in cognitive disorder, defined by a drop of 2 points in the Mini-Mental State Examination
Time frame: Baseline and 7 days
Detectable levels of inflammatory biomarkers in bloodstream, such as: P-selectin (CD62p- ng/ml), CD40L soluble (ng/ml), s100B (ng/ml)
Time frame: Change from baseline at 6 hours and 24 hours after surgery
Delirium assessed using the Confusion Assessment Method (CAM)
Time frame: 24 hours after surgery
Sternotomy Pain assessed using the Visual Analogue Scale
Time frame: 24 hours after surgery
